The creative cooperation of architects and engineers in an integrated and simultaneous process and the overriding desire to create a better environment for our children are necessary preconditions if we are to achieve our goals.
We employ our expertise and experience in every phase of the design process in order to create innovative, resource-saving and energy-optimised buildings of the highest aesthetic quality. In this work we are guided by a holistic definition of sustainability which is based on three pillars. The economic pillar seeks to optimise costs across the entire lifespan of the building. The ecological pillar requires us to invest our design energy in the development of solutions which minimise the use of resources. The social pillar demands that our buildings improve the lot of users, observers and the affected urban structure.
ATP is a founder member of the DGNB and the ÖGNI and a member of the DGNB working group developing a new system of certification for educational, retail and hospital buildings. The ATP research subsidiary ATP sustain offers certification services in line with DGNB, BREEAM, LEED, ÖGNI and Minergie-eco.
